How to I pair multiple devices?
I have en Edge 810 that have been working flawless for over 1 year now. Auto uploading after every trip. But when i connected my new Vivosmart to the connect.garmin app. The the Edge 810 cant connect anymore. I have to remove the pair with Vivosmart first.

And this is quite boring if I'm out biking every day.
